How Build Verification Test or BVT is performed? - 0 views

  •  
    Build Verification Test (BVT) is a set of tests that is executed on every new software build to assess and verify its readiness to face off & undergo through more thorough & rigorous testing procedures. Few of its important features are: Executed on every new build. Test cases are of shorter duration Automation is preferred to execute BVT cases

What is Smoke Testing? - 0 views

  •  
    A preliminary test performed over the initial build of the software, Smoke Testing verifies the stability & readiness of the build, to prevent system crashes and failure during further testing. It is termed as a build verification testing, as it is primarily used to reject software build(s) and declare it unstable for further testing, at first sight.
